随着区块链技术的飞速发展,区块链钱包作为一个重要的组成部分,越来越受到用户和开发者的关注。钱包地址的识别率直接影响到交易的安全和效率,因此,提升钱包地址的识别率成为了越来越多开发者和企业关注的焦点。本文将围绕这一主题展开深入讨论,探索提升区块链钱包地址识别率的有效策略和技巧,帮助用户更好地理解这一技术细节。

1. 什么是区块链钱包地址识别率?

区块链钱包地址识别率指的是系统能够有效识别、验证和解析钱包地址的能力。在区块链系统中,钱包地址是用来接收和发送数字货币的唯一识别符号。高识别率意味着系统能够更快、更准确地处理交易请求,降低交易失败的风险。

在探讨提升识别率的方法之前,首先需要明确区块链钱包地址的构成。典型的钱包地址由一串字母和数字组成,它们通常是经过哈希算法处理后生成的,这就导致了极大的地址组合可能性。然而,这也意味着在处理这些地址时,技术系统往往面临着许多挑战。

2. 提升区块链钱包地址识别率的主要策略

提升钱包地址识别率可以从多个角度进行,包括技术手段、用户体验和教育宣传等。下面就针对这些主要策略进行详细介绍:

2.1 技术手段的应用

在技术层面,采用先进的算法对钱包地址进行识别和验证是提升识别率的关键。这些算法可以通过机器学习和深度学习等方法来不断其识别能力。例如,训练模型以识别不同格式的钱包地址,有助于提高其匹配速度和准确率。

2.2 用户体验的

用户体验的也是提升钱包地址识别率不可忽视的一部分。当用户在提交钱包地址时,如果系统能够实时反馈地址的有效性,比如提供即时的格式验证或提示信息,将会有效减少交易失败的情况。此外,在设计钱包地址输入界面时,尽量避免复杂的输入方式,采用简单明了的设计也可以减少用户的错误操作。

2.3 教育用户的重要性

在区块链环境中,用户的错误输入是导致钱包地址识别失败的主要原因之一。因此,教育用户掌握正确的输入方式和注意事项显得尤为重要。可以通过用户指南、视频教程等多种形式对用户进行教育,强化其对地址格式的认识,降低可能出现的错误概率。

3. 如何检测钱包地址的有效性?

检测钱包地址的有效性是提高识别率的重要环节。有效性检测通常包括格式校验、地址生成算法验证等步骤。具体来说,可以从以下几个步骤来实现:

3.1 格式校验

首先,确认钱包地址是否符合区块链网络的标准格式。各个区块链网络如比特币、以太坊等都有其特定的地址格式,比如比特币地址通常以1、3或bc1开头,而以太坊地址为0x开头。开发团队在系统中,可以设置正则表达式来校验地址的格式是否符合要求。

3.2 地址生成算法的验证

各个区块链钱包生成地址所使用的算法一般是不可逆的哈希算法,因此在检测时可以尝试逆向生成该地址并与输入的地址进行对比。这一过程可以有效地识别出伪造或错误格式的地址,从而提升识别率。

3.3 反馈机制的建立

实时的反馈机制对于钱包地址的有效性检测也非常重要。无论是用户在输入地址时,还是交易提交后,系统都可以及时给出反馈。比如,若用户输入了一个潜在的错误格式,系统应及时弹出提示,并建议用户更正输入内容。

4. 实际案例分析

为了更好地理解提升钱包地址识别率的策略,下面通过几个实际案例进行分析。我们将分享几个成功的区块链项目是如何解决钱包地址识别率问题的。

4.1 案例一:Coinbase

Coinbase作为全球知名的数字货币交易平台,其在提升钱包地址识别率方面采取了一系列有效的措施。首先,它在用户界面上进行了,使得用户在输入钱包地址时可以选用复制-粘贴方式,再配合实时的格式检查,显著降低了用户输入错误的概率。

4.2 案例二:MetaMask

MetaMask是一个广泛使用的以太坊钱包,它通过加强对地址生成算法的验证来提升识别率。此外,在用户教育方面,MetaMask也做得非常出色,通过在应用内建立用户指南和常见问题解答来帮助用户提高对地址正确输入的认知。

4.3 案例三:Binance

作为领先的全球数字货币交易所,Binance在以用户为中心的设计实践中,建立了多重验证机制。例如,用户在提币时,系统不仅对地址进行格式校验,还会通过电子邮件或手机短信进行确认。这些多层次的安全措施极大地提升了钱包地址的识别率和安全性。

5. 常见问题与解答

在增加区块链钱包地址识别率的过程中,用户和开发者往往会遇到一些共性问题。以下是几个与此主题密切相关的问题及其解答:

5.1 钱包地址格式出错会带来什么样的后果?

钱包地址格式出错是导致交易失败的最常见原因之一,轻则影响交易速度,重则可能导致资金损失。一旦用户发送汇款到错误地址,该笔交易将无法追回。此外,格式错误还可能影响到整个区块链系统的正常运行,造成网络拥堵,影响用户体验。

5.2 机器学习如何提升钱包地址的识别率?

机器学习作为一项前沿技术,其在数据处理和模式识别方面的应用,可以大幅度提升钱包地址的识别率。通过标记大量的有效与无效地址,训练算法能够通过识别样本特征来改善未来的识别能力,进而减少人工审核的需求,提升整个系统的处理效率。

5.3 如何处理用户输入的错误地址?

处理用户输入的错误地址是提升识别率的重要环节。在此,可以采取自动校正、智能提示及互动指导等方式。例如,当系统检测到用户输入的地址格式不正确时,可以提供实时反馈,并引导用户检查输入是否与标准格式一致。此外,开发者也可以设计一个支持用户反馈的系统,收集用户在使用过程中遇到的问题,进行后续。

5.4 区块链钱包地址的未来:还有哪些改进的空间?

区块链钱包地址的未来发展潜力巨大。在可预见的将来,发展将集中在增强安全性和提高用户体验等几个方面。比如,集成生物识别技术来验证交易的合法性,或通过构建更加完善的地址生成协议来减少人为错误。此外,随着科技的发展,可能出现更为简化的地址理念,如使用短链接或二维码进行交易,都能够显著提升钱包地址的有效性和识别率。

综上所述,提高区块链钱包地址的识别率是一个复杂而重要的任务。通过技术手段的应用、用户体验的以及用户教育相结合的方法,可以有效地提升这项能力。在未来的发展中,随着区块链技术的不断演进,我们有理由相信这种识别率将进一步得到增强,从而推动整个区块链行业的发展。